ERA: "Rich Text Control Has Not Been Installed" Error

The following error message occurs upon loading the ERA power client. Clicking No will grant the user access to ERA, however, the rich text fields will be grayed out.

This error occurs when ERA is installed using a Windows account that does not have sufficient permissions to the machine, which then prevents the Rich Text control from being registered at the time of installation. Users on the following operating systems may experience this error:

  • Windows Server 2008 R2 and later
  • Windows 7 and later

To prevent the error, a user with Administrator privileges should install ERA, however, if this is not possible, the problem can often be resolved by following the steps in Option 1 below. In some cases, the problem may persist due to the User Access Control settings. If this is the case, follow the steps in Option 2.

Option 1: Run the Rich Text Batch File as an Administrator

  1. Navigate to C:\Program Files (x86)\Methodware\lib\RichEdit
  2. Right-click on either the install.bat or mwrt.bat file (the file saved to your system depends on your version of ERA), then select Run as Administrator.

Option 2: Manually Register the Rich Text Component

  1. Navigate to C:\Program Files (x86)\Methodware\lib\RichEdit.
  2. Copy the RICHTX32.OCX file and move it to the C:\Windows\System32 folder.
  3. Navigate to Command Prompt, then right-click it and select Run as administrator.
  4. In Command Prompt, type regsvr32.exe C:\Windows\SysWOW64\RICHTX32.OCX, then press Enter on your keyboard.
